Rosuvastatin Clinical Uses: Lipid-Lowering and Cardiovascular Disease Prevention
Rosuvastatin for Dyslipidemia and Hypercholesterolemia
Rosuvastatin is a highly effective statin used to treat dyslipidemia and primary hypercholesterolemia. It significantly lowers low-density lipoprotein cholesterol (LDL-C) by 34–65% across a range of doses, with a typical starting dose of 10 mg reducing LDL-C by about 50%—enough to help most patients reach recommended cholesterol targets. Rosuvastatin also increases high-density lipoprotein cholesterol (HDL-C) and is more potent than atorvastatin in lowering LDL-C, making it a preferred choice for many patients with high cholesterol or at risk for cardiovascular disease 129.
Rosuvastatin in Cardiovascular Disease Prevention
Rosuvastatin is widely used for both primary and secondary prevention of cardiovascular events. Its benefits extend beyond cholesterol lowering, as it also has anti-inflammatory, antioxidant, and antithrombotic effects. These properties make it a crucial tool in reducing the risk of heart attacks, strokes, and other cardiovascular complications in at-risk individuals 24.
Stroke Prevention with Rosuvastatin
Clinical trials have shown that rosuvastatin can reduce the risk of stroke, particularly ischemic stroke, by more than half in people with low LDL-C but elevated C-reactive protein levels. This effect is consistent across different patient groups, highlighting rosuvastatin’s role in stroke prevention for those with increased cardiovascular risk .
Rosuvastatin for Venous Thromboembolism (VTE) and Coagulation
Rosuvastatin has been shown to improve coagulation profiles and increase plasma fibrinolytic potential in patients with a history of venous thromboembolism (VTE). It lowers levels of several coagulation factors and enhances the body’s ability to break down clots, suggesting a possible role in the secondary prevention of VTE 58.
Rosuvastatin in Metabolic Associated Fatty Liver Disease (MAFLD)
Recent studies indicate that rosuvastatin can significantly reduce liver fat content in patients with moderate to severe metabolic associated fatty liver disease (MAFLD) and metabolic syndrome, without causing significant safety concerns. This suggests a potential benefit for patients with fatty liver disease who also have dyslipidemia or metabolic syndrome .
Combination Therapy: Rosuvastatin/Ezetimibe
Rosuvastatin is also available in combination with ezetimibe, which further enhances cholesterol lowering by inhibiting intestinal cholesterol absorption. This fixed-dose combination is more effective than rosuvastatin alone in reducing LDL-C and helps more patients achieve their cholesterol goals, with a similar safety profile .
Effects on Atherosclerotic Plaque and Subclinical Atherosclerosis
Rosuvastatin reduces active microcalcification in atherosclerotic plaques, as shown by imaging studies. This effect may contribute to plaque stabilization and reduced risk of cardiovascular events in high-risk individuals with subclinical atherosclerosis .
Conclusion
Rosuvastatin is a potent and versatile statin used primarily for lowering cholesterol and preventing cardiovascular disease. Its clinical uses include treating dyslipidemia, reducing the risk of heart attack and stroke, improving coagulation in VTE patients, reducing liver fat in MAFLD, and stabilizing atherosclerotic plaques.
